基于串级PID的机器鱼位姿控制算法
Posture Control Algorithm of Robotic Fish Based on Cascade PID作者机构:白城师范学院机械与控制工程学院吉林白城137000 长春大学机械与车辆工程学院长春130022
出 版 物:《吉林大学学报(理学版)》 (Journal of Jilin University:Science Edition)
年 卷 期:2022年第60卷第3期
页 面:734-742页
学科分类:080901[工学-物理电子学] 0809[工学-电子科学与技术(可授工学、理学学位)] 08[工学] 080401[工学-精密仪器及机械] 0804[工学-仪器科学与技术] 0803[工学-光学工程]
基 金:吉林省教育厅科学技术研究项目(批准号:JJKH20210004KJ)
主 题:机器鱼 位姿控制 URWPGSim2D仿真平台 多水下机器人协作控制系统平台
摘 要:针对三关节仿生机器鱼的位姿控制问题,首先,介绍三关节仿生机器鱼的硬件结构及其运动控制系统;其次,基于期望位姿建立坐标系,构建机器鱼的位姿误差模型;再次,在串级比例-积分-微分(PID)控制系统的基础上,提出基于串级PID的仿生机器鱼位姿控制算法;最后,在URWPGSim2D仿真平台和多水下机器人协作控制系统平台下分别进行算法仿真实验和实体实验.实验结果表明:与时变反馈控制算法相比,基于串级PID算法的仿真机器鱼到达目标位姿所用时间增加,但位置误差和方向角误差减小,位姿控制的精度提高;仿生机器鱼到达期望位姿所用时间为14.4 s,位姿误差为(-3像素,-4像素,0.062 rad),基本满足循迹和搬运等应用要求,验证了算法的有效性.